Default Zoom H1n Guitar and vocals

Was wondering if I can get some tips on placement with this? Just got one today, never recorded a thing before, and this seems plenty for my needs. SQ is very good when uploaded.

Guitar sounds great, but vocals can get lost easily. I put the H1 on the desk in front of me standing up, but can't seem to capture the vocals as clearly.

If the vocals are getting lost you need to move the H1 closer to your mouth. The easiest ($$) way to do this is with a mic boom stand and an adapter for the 1/4" thread on the H1.

I have an H4n and typically use it about 12-16 inches away pointed toward the soundhole at about a 35 - 45 degree angle from the fretboard in the deadest room i have. A dead box is helpful too..... which is basically a box that surrounds the mic (s) to prevent muddled sound coming from behind the mics. Experiment with locations and capturing the gtr and vocals with a unit like this in one take is a compromise. Heres a link with some good ideas..... http://www.bluestemstrings.com/pageRecording1.html
